PackageDescriptionThis package contains BFD and opcodes static and dynamic libraries. The dynamic libraries are in this package, rather than a separate base package because they are actually linker scripts that force the use of the static libraries. This is because the API of the BFD library is too unstable to be used dynamically. The static libraries are here because they are now needed by the dynamic libraries. Developers starting new projects are strongly encouraged to consider using libelf instead of BFD.
